1964 MGB Convertible Coupe Stalled Restoration Project Ready for You to Restore CONDITION: PARTIALLY DISASSEMBLED, rolling chassis. Engine and transmission out. Clear Maryland Title in my name. Lots of photos here in this ad. These and many others are posted here: http://s1049.photobucket.com/albums/s400/littlelocosME/ ENGINE: Engine partially disassembled for cleaning, but appears to be in good condition. Engine parts bagged and tagged as they were removed. Some parts sand or bead blasted and painted (oil pan, timing chain cover, fan, pulley, intake manifold, thermostat housing -- see pics) Cylinders, crank, cam, cam chain, valves, etc. look good and should present no real problem to complete. Engine turns over with no appreciable play. Appears that previous owner may have done some rebuilding here; however, there is no record of the work so this is not guaranteed. Most gaskets and hardware needed to reassemble engine have been purchased and will be included with sale.Includes rebuilt generator along with original generator and starter which need rebuilding. BODY: Overall, restorable. Some major, typical rust as seen in pics. Doors shut properly, no body sag that I can see. Driver's side door has been replaced with a push-button door and strike. Complete replacement door included to convert it back to original, pushbutton lock and strike. Rust at bottom of front fenders, outside and mid-panel under doors (inner door sills appear solid, but have not been fully exposed from the inside). Includes NEW Rover-brand rocker panels ($136.95/ea at Moss Motors) Includes two, complete replacement doors in excellent condition. (complete with glass, locksets, window hardware and original door interior panel.) Includes replacement, complete trunk lid to replace the original, rusted one Original, aluminum hood is in great shape Floors are rusty and should be replaced. (see pics) Rust around the headlights and rusty headlights should be repaird and/or replaced. Trunk (boot) floor appears solid, but does have some rust. There is some evidence of previous, bondo repairs near the lower fenders. We have pulled some of this off to expose some of the repairs. Gas tank is rusty and should be replaced. Original wheels (includes all 5) should be sandblasted and painted. Hubcaps (includes all 4) should be rechromed. Bumpers should be rechromed. Grill is in ok condition and will need some repairs or replacement. Included new side mouldings Will need complete interior kit. Seats are usable, but have holes near the base of the seat cushions. On Aug-28-12 at 18:25:09 PDT, seller added the following information: NOTE: This car is listed as a 1964 MGB. Checking the serial number, it is actually a 1963 -- a very early "B" indeed. It is titled in Maryland (and previously in Pennsylvania) as a 1964. From my research, the 1964 model year started with GHN3L19586. The engine number plate is missing; however, under the rear felt seal is the number 22834 (see Photobucket pics). Given the early head and head casting date of 1963, this should match the rest of the car. Since the engine was not in the car when we purchased it 3 years ago, I have never seen it in the car. I purchased the car, in pieces, from a long-time owner and driver. He had no other MG's that we saw. My assumption at this point is that the correct engine number would be 18G/UH/22834.
